
Prentus is an AI-powered career success platform designed to transform job searching for students, universities, and employers. It offers an integrated solution combining gamified job search tools, advising automation, employer partnerships, community engagement, and real-time outcome tracking. The platform eliminates up to 80% of administrative work for career services teams, enabling students to get hired 54% faster. Trusted by over 900 schools and used by more than 12,000 job seekers, Prentus provides features like job tracking, AI resume and LinkedIn analysis, automated task assignments, employer CRM, and a branded recruiting platform. Its unique gamification approach drives 3x more engagement, making job searching more effective and enjoyable, positioning Prentus as a leading career services platform for outcome-driven educational institutions and workforce development.

What: AI-powered career outcomes platform for students and outcome-focused educational institutions
Traction: Helped 12,000+ jobseekers from 900+ schools (reported Mar 2024)
Product: AI job-search tools, gamified engagement, advising automation, employer CRM, and outcomes tracking
Founder: Rod Danan
Funding (latest): Funding announced Apr 28, 2025; amount not disclosed; led by Potencia Ventures and LearnLaunch

Announcement named additional individual backers including Jamie Farrell and Jonathan Finkelstein; amount not disclosed. Prentus stated it was profitable prior to this round.
